What the Candidate Will Do:
- Design and develop next-generation ad products and formats, ensuring seamless integration into Uber’s user experiences.
- Build high-performance, scalable ad-serving capabilities that power native ads, video ads, and interactive ad experiences.
- Lead the technical direction for ad product innovation, driving the evolution of Uber’s advertising ecosystem.
- Optimize ad ranking, targeting, and auction mechanics to maximize engagement and revenue.
- Work closely with Product, Design, Machine Learning, and Data Science teams to craft compelling ad experiences.
- Ensure seamless ad rendering, fast load times, and high-quality user experiences across Uber’s apps.
- Drive A/B testing, experimentation, and ad measurement strategies to optimize ad effectiveness.
- Influence long-term technical roadmap, architecture decisions, and engineering best practices for the Ads Engineering Org.
- Mentor and coach engineers, fostering a culture of technical excellence and innovation.
Basic Qualifications:
- Bachelor’s or Master’s degree in Computer Science, Engineering, or a related field.
- Minimum 8 years of software engineering experience, with expertise in building and scaling ad products.
- Strong proficiency in Java, Scala, Python, or Golang for backend development.
- Expertise in distributed systems and micro-services architecture.
- Experience with SQL, NoSQL databases, caching, and large-scale storage solutions.
- Excellent problem-solving, system design, and leadership skills.
Preferred Qualifications :
- Track record of leading technical initiatives and mentoring engineers in high-growth environments.
- Experience in AdTech, programmatic advertising, or in-app ad monetization.
- Strong understanding of native ads, video ads, interactive ad units, and rich media experiences.
- Hands-on experience in A/B testing, experimentation platforms, and ad effectiveness measurement.
- Familiarity with privacy-preserving advertising, attribution modeling, and fraud prevention.
- Experience working with streaming frameworks like Kafka, Flink, or Spark for real-time data processing.
For New York, NY-based roles: The base salary range for this role is USD$223,000 per year - USD$248,000 per year.
For San Francisco, CA-based roles: The base salary range for this role is USD$223,000 per year - USD$248,000 per year.
For Sunnyvale, CA-based roles: The base salary range for this role is USD$223,000 per year - USD$248,000 per year.